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ration in the Area

Don’t wait until it’s too late – catch these warning signs early to prevent costly repairs and health risks. Our team has seen it all, from musty odors to water stains.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ent smell in your condo, it’s time to call our team. We’ll identify the source of the odor and fix the issue before it spreads.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or pipe. Don’t ignore them – call our team to assess the damage and make repairs. We’ll ensure that your condo is safe and secure.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and make repairs to ensure that your condo is safe and stable.

Discolored or Peeling Paint

Discolored or peeling paint can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and make repairs to ensure that your condo is safe and secure.

Mold Growth in the Attic or Basement

Mold growth in the attic or basement can be a sign of hidden water damage. Our team will assess the damage and make repairs to ensure that your condo is safe and healthy.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. Our team will assess the damage and make repairs to ensure that your condo is safe and secure.

Condo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No You can fix a small leak yourself with a DIY kit.
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ms No Yes A large area of water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to dry and clean.
Hidden water damage behind walls or in the attic No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ix.
Water damage with m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s professional equ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ent future growth.
Water damage with structural damage to walls or floors No Yes Structural damage needs professional expertise to repair and ensure the safety of your condo.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lenox, MA

The cost of condo water damage restoration in Lenox, MA can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. We’ll also work with your insurance company to ensure that you get the reimbursement you deserve.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500-$2,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age
Removal and Disposal of Damaged Materials $1,000-$5,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500-$6,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$1,000-$3,000 Size of the affected area, type of cleaning products used
Repair and Replacement of Damaged Structures $2,000-$10,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ged
